Is it normal to feel guilty after a breakup?


Is it normal to feel guilty after a breakup? Feeling guilty for ending a relationship is normal, especially if you’ve hurt someone that you once loved and still care about. If they didn’t see it coming, then it will be a complete shock to them, and they will be struggling to process it and catch up with where you’re at.

How do you deal with the guilt of ending a relationship? To overcome feelings of guilt, reassure yourself that ending a relationship isn’t a failure or a sign of your inadequacies. It’s a normal occurrence, although people don’t often talk about it openly. Give yourself permission to do what’s right for you.

Should I feel guilty about a breakup? Guilt implies you did something wrong. Doing what’s best for you is never wrong. You should never let feelings of guilt get in the way of you doing you. Sadness, anger, and all those kinds of feelings are normal and healthy breakup fodder.

How do narcissists act after breakup?

At the end of a relationship, narcissists may become combative, passive-aggressive, hostile, and even more controlling. People with NPD often fail to understand other people’s needs and values. They are hyper focused on their egos, but do not account for how their actions affect others.

Do breakups hit guys later?

While the stereotype is that a breakup hits men a lot later, emerging research conducted with 184,000 participants found that men seem to be more affected by the loss of a relationship.

Why do guys go cold after breakup?

In reality, men experience more emotional pain after a breakup. They also need more time to move on from heartbreak. Since many guys are not comfortable displaying their emotions, they become avoidant. Loss of a relationship is often a common cause of why men go cold suddenly.
